溫馨提示×

如何在CentOS上安裝Java并配置路徑

小樊
58
2025-06-24 08:40:53
欄目: 編程語言

在CentOS上安裝Java并配置路徑的步驟如下:

1. 下載Java安裝包

首先,你需要下載適用于CentOS的Java安裝包。你可以從Oracle官網或者OpenJDK官網下載。

Oracle JDK

wget --no-check-certificate --no-cookies --header "Cookie: oraclelicense=accept-securebackup-cookie" http://download.oracle.com/otn-pub/java/jdk/17.0.1+12/42970487e3af4f5aa5bca3f542482c60/jdk-17.0.1_linux-x64_bin.tar.gz

OpenJDK

sudo yum install java-17-openjdk-devel

2. 安裝Java

如果你下載的是Oracle JDK的安裝包,你需要解壓并移動到合適的位置。

# 解壓安裝包
tar -zxvf jdk-17.0.1_linux-x64_bin.tar.gz -C /usr/lib/jvm

# 移動到合適的位置
sudo mv /usr/lib/jvm/jdk-17.0.1 /usr/lib/jvm/java-17-openjdk

3. 配置環境變量

編輯/etc/profile文件或者~/.bashrc文件來配置Java環境變量。

編輯 /etc/profile

sudo nano /etc/profile

在文件末尾添加以下內容:

export JAVA_HOME=/usr/lib/jvm/java-17-openjdk
export PATH=$PATH:$JAVA_HOME/bin

保存并退出編輯器,然后使配置生效:

source /etc/profile

編輯 ~/.bashrc

nano ~/.bashrc

在文件末尾添加以下內容:

export JAVA_HOME=/usr/lib/jvm/java-17-openjdk
export PATH=$PATH:$JAVA_HOME/bin

保存并退出編輯器,然后使配置生效:

source ~/.bashrc

4. 驗證安裝

驗證Java是否安裝成功并配置正確:

java -version

你應該能看到類似以下的輸出:

openjdk version "17.0.1" 2021-10-19
OpenJDK Runtime Environment (build 17.0.1+12-39)
OpenJDK 64-Bit Server VM (build 17.0.1+12-39, mixed mode, sharing)

5. 配置Java路徑(可選)

如果你需要配置多個Java版本或者特定的Java路徑,可以使用update-alternatives工具。

sudo update-alternatives --install /usr/bin/java java /usr/lib/jvm/java-17-openjdk/bin/java 1
sudo update-alternatives --install /usr/bin/javac javac /usr/lib/jvm/java-17-openjdk/bin/javac 1

然后選擇你需要的Java版本:

sudo update-alternatives --config java
sudo update-alternatives --config javac

按照提示選擇你需要的Java版本即可。

通過以上步驟,你應該能夠在CentOS上成功安裝并配置Java。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女